Analysis

Austria recorded 0.9% for barro-lee: percentage of population age 35-39 with primary schooling. in 2010. That is the lowest value across all 11 years on record.

The figure is down 81.3% over ten years.

Over the whole period, barro-lee: percentage of population age 35-39 with primary schooling. in Austria peaked at 33.8% in 1960 and was at its lowest, 0.9%, in 2010.

Austria ranks 100th of 144 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Barro-Lee: Percentage of population age 35-39 with primary schooling. in Austria, year by year

Annual values for Barro-Lee: Percentage of population age 35-39 with primary schooling. Incompleted Primary in Austria, 1960 to 2010.
Year Value Change
1960 33.8%
1965 23.9% -29.4%
1970 16.8% -29.6%
1975 13.4% -20.0%
1980 9.4% -30.3%
1985 8.7% -7.4%
1990 7.3% -16.1%
1995 5.0% -32.0%
2000 4.8% -3.8%
2005 3.8% -19.7%
2010 0.9% -76.7%
